🛒 The Fluffiest Diner-Style Pancake Ingredients

To get that thick, golden, fluffy stack just like the one in


you only need kitchen staples:

  • The Dry Mix: 2 cups of all-purpose flour, 3 tbsp of sugar, 2 tsp of baking powder, and 1/2 tsp of salt.

  • The Wet Mix: 1 and 1/2 cups of milk, 1/4 cup of melted butter (the secret to rich flavor), and 2 large eggs.

  • The Toppings: A massive cube of real butter and plenty of warm maple syrup.

👩‍🍳 Quick Step-by-Step Instructions

  1. Whisk Gently: Combine the dry ingredients in a large bowl. In another bowl, whisk the milk, eggs, and melted butter. Pour the wet into the dry and mix just until combined. (Pro-tip: Don't overmix! A few lumps in the batter make the pancakes fluffier).

  2. The Hot Skillet: Heat a non-stick skillet or griddle over medium heat and grease lightly with butter.

  3. The Flip: Pour 1/3 cup of batter per pancake. Wait until you see tiny bubbles forming on the surface and the edges look set. Flip gently and cook for another 1 to 2 minutes until golden brown.

  4. Serve for Supper: Stack them high, add a generous slice of butter on top, and drench them in warm syrup exactly like


    . Pair with crispy bacon or scrambled eggs for the perfect sweet-and-savory evening meal!
